RV Snowbirds throughout the southern California desert communities decked their dashboards and trimmed the hitches of the motorhomes during this holiday season, states an article written by Rebecca Walsh in The Desert Sun, posted on Christmas morning.

“The RV community is by definition a nomadic one, but that doesn’t mean that Christmas traditions get left behind along with the heavy furniture and the permanent address. But there is definitely some scaling back that comes with the cruising lifestyle,” wrote Walsh.
